weakpass_edit(8) BSD System Manager's Manual weakpass_edit(8)NAMEweakpass_edit -- Mac OS X Server Password Server weak password dictionary insertion toolSYNOPSISadd [[-p passphrase] | [-f file]] delete [[-p passphrase] | [-f file]]DESCRIPTIONweakpass_edit Adds weak or undesirable passwords to a dictionary of passwords to be rejected by the password server. weakpass_edit must be run as root; it will exit otherwise. This tool's purpose is to manage the weak password dictionary.OPTIONSThe following options are available: -p add or delete a passphrase, provided as a command-line argument, to the weak password database. -f add or delete all passphrases contained in a file.USAGEFILES & FOLDERS /var/db/authserver - the password server database repository. The weak password files are here. /var/db/authserver/weakpasswords.[n] - an alphabetized list of weak passwords to reject.SEE ALSOPasswordService(8) mkpassdb(8) Mac OS X Server 21 February 2002 Mac OS X Server
